DRIVE CHAIN

Refer to the Safety Precautions on page 6.
The service life of the drive chain is
dependent upon proper lubrication and
adjustment. Poor maintenance can cause
premature wear or damage to the drive
chain and sprockets.
The drive chain should be checked and
lubricated as part of the Pre-ride Inspection
(page 41). Under severe usage, or when
the vehicle is ridden in unusually dusty or
muddy areas, more frequent maintenance
will be necessary.
Inspection:
1. Turn the engine off, place the vehicle
on its center stand, and shift the
transmission into neutral.
2. Remove the inspection cap (1). Move
the drive chain (2) up and down with
your finger. Drive chain slack should
be adjusted approximately to allow the
following vertical movement by hand:
30-40 mm (1.2-1.5 in)

3. Rotate the rear wheel slightly and then
stop to check the drive chain slackness
again. Repeat this procedure several
times. Drive chain slack should remain
constant. If the chain is slack only in
certain sections, some links are kinked
and binding, kinking can be eliminated
by lubrication.
